Which substance allows the kidney to excrete acid without excessively lowering urine pH?

  1. Bicarbonate
  2. Ammonia
  3. Chloride
  4. Phosphate only
Show answer and explanation

Correct answer: Ammonia

Ammonia buffers hydrogen ions in the tubular fluid. This allows excretion of acid as ammonium.
